Upstart Holdings, Inc. (UPST) experienced a significant 5.10% plummet in its stock price on Thursday, February 13, 2025, amid market volatility and concerns surrounding its growth prospects.

The broader US stock market faced selling pressure, with major indices like the Dow and S&P 500 closing lower due to rising Treasury yields following a hotter-than-expected inflation report. In this environment, growth companies like Upstart Holdings, which operates a cloud-based AI lending platform, faced heightened scrutiny.

While Upstart Holdings reported impressive earnings growth forecasts of 107.6% per annum, the company faced challenges related to profitability and insider selling. Despite aiming for revenue of approximately $1 billion in 2025, Upstart Holdings reported a net loss of $128.58 million in 2024, raising concerns about its ability to achieve sustained profitability in the near future.
